Subject: [PATCH] accel/rocket: search every core slot when looking up a scheduler

sched_to_core() walks rdev->cores[] up to rdev->num_cores, and
rocket_remove() decrements num_cores for every core it removes. Unbind a
core that is not the last one and the cores behind it fall outside the
search, so sched_to_core() returns NULL for a core that is still bound and
still running jobs. Neither caller checks the result:
rocket_job_run(): rocket_fence_create(core), core->dev
rocket_job_timedout(): dev_err(core->dev, "NPU job timed out")
Unbinding the middle core of the three on an RK3588 while three clients are
submitting to all of them faults twice, once from the surviving core's
job queue and once from its reset work:
KASAN: null-ptr-deref in range [0x0000000000000220-0x0000000000000227]
Workqueue: fdad0000.npu drm_sched_run_job_work [gpu_sched]
pc : rocket_job_run+0x234/0x838 [rocket]
Call trace:
rocket_job_run+0x234/0x838 [rocket]
drm_sched_run_job_work+0x2cc/0xad8 [gpu_sched]
process_one_work+0x640/0x14f0
KASAN: null-ptr-deref in range [0x0000000000000000-0x0000000000000007]
Workqueue: rocket-reset-2 drm_sched_job_timedout [gpu_sched]
pc : rocket_job_timedout+0xf0/0x1e0 [rocket]
Call trace:
rocket_job_timedout+0xf0/0x1e0 [rocket]
drm_sched_job_timedout+0x188/0x6a0 [gpu_sched]
Both are the third core: the workqueue names are its device and its
core->index, and it was left at slot 2 while num_cores had dropped to 2.
Search all the slots that were allocated, the way find_core_for_dev() now
does. A core that is still bound is then found, and the two callers get
the pointer they already assume they have.
This does not make unbinding one core out of several safe. An open client
keeps an entity pointing at the scheduler of the core that went away:
drm_sched reports it as not ready for every job that lands on it, and the
client waits in dma_fence_default_wait for a fence that will never signal.
Stopping the NULL dereference is what belongs in a fix; the rest wants
more thought.

diff --git a/drivers/accel/rocket/rocket_job.c b/drivers/accel/rocket/rocket_job.c
index 3141f210fcd1b..a6c24dfe0563a 100644
--- a/drivers/accel/rocket/rocket_job.c
+++ b/drivers/accel/rocket/rocket_job.c
@@ -283,7 +283,7 @@ static struct rocket_core *sched_to_core(struct rocket_device *rdev,
{
unsigned int core;
- for (core = 0; core < rdev->num_cores; core++) {
+ for (core = 0; core < rdev->max_cores; core++) {
if (&rdev->cores[core].sched == sched)
return &rdev->cores[core];
}
